Tor uses a search engine called 'Disconnect' It is a meta search engine using a combination of results from Google, Bing, Yahoo and others but protecting your privacy in the process. It also forces web sites to disconnect from you once you leave their page. https://disconnect.me/ It is also available as an add on to Chrome and Fire Fox.
Also, if you are using Chrome with a VPN you will need to use an add on for the Web RTC leaks which expose your real IP address. You can get it as an add on. http://lifehacker.com/how-to-see-if-your...1685180082 and https://torrentfreak.com/google-publishe...le-150729/
